We are Mirabilis Collective — an intergenerational ensemble of women musicians on Whadjuk Boodja in Western Australia, united by a simple belief: women's music deserves to be heard.

From centuries-old classical works to contemporary commissions, from folk traditions to reimagined songwriting — we perform music by women across every genre and era. Our concerts are conversations: between past and present, between generations, between performers and audiences.

We champion Western Australian artists and underrepresented voices from around the world. Through storytelling, mentorship, and musical excellence, we ensure that women's creative legacy doesn't just survive — it thrives, evolves, and inspires.

Our Impact

Since 2023, we've performed works by over 90 women composers, collaborated with leading arts institutions, and brought music into schools and communities across Western Australia — both metropolitan and regional. Our commitment to excellence, inclusivity, and accessibility ensures that women's contributions to chamber music are not only acknowledged but celebrated.

Through mentorship and intergenerational collaboration, we've created pathways for emerging composers and performers to establish themselves professionally. We've commissioned new works that reflect our unique experiences as women and as Australians, adding to the living repertoire of chamber music. PERTH OPERA VOICES

GENRES: Opera - Classical - Musical Theatre

Established in 2024, Perth Opera Voices (P.O.V.) is a vibrant vocal collective dedicated to creating performance opportunities for emerging Perth opera artists.

With four highly successful tours across West Australia’s south-west under their belt, as well as countless Perth showcases and events, P.O.V. continues to share the magic of opera throughout the state.

True to their name, their performances showcase opera from an exciting, and distinctive - Point Of View, offering fresh takes on timeless classics. With the use of ‘story vignettes’, opera favourites are distilled into minutes rather than hours; their essence captured with both charm and emotion.

Alongside masterpieces from the likes of Mozart, Rossini, Puccini, and Verdi, the singers will weave in the playful narratives of theatre classics and transport audiences to the Golden Age of Hollywood with show stopping numbers from Rodgers and Hammerstein, Gilbert and Sullivan and the legendary Sondheim.

Our singers are also contracted with Freeze Frame Opera, West Australian Opera, The Melba Trust, Pacific Opera [Sydney], the West Australian Symphonic Chorus, Opus WA, Perth Symphonic Chorus, the Metropolitan Symphony Orchestra, St George's Cathedral, and St Paul's Chapel
